Legendary actor Jackie Chan has expressed his shock and
heartbreak over the recent arrest of his 31 year old son,
Jaycee Chan, who was picked up & detained last Thursday
after 100 grams of m*******a was discovered at his home.
Police said Jaycee and another man found in his home,
Taiwanese movie star Kai Ko, 23, tested positive for
m*******a and admitted using the drug.
Jackie, who was made an anti-drug ambassador in China in
2009, took to his website today to express his sadness over
his son’s behaviour and apologized to the public
“Regarding this issue with my son Jaycee, I feel very
angry and very shocked. As a public figure, I’m very
ashamed. As a father, I’m heartbroken. Jaycee and I
together express our deep apology to society and the
public’ Chan wrote.
“I hope all young people will learn a lesson from Jaycee
and stay far from the harm of drugs. I say to Jaycee that
you have to accept the consequences when you do
something wrong. As your father, I’m going to face the
road together with you.’
Jaycee was also accused of aiding and abetting other drug
users. He faces up to three years in jail if found guilty. The
Chinese government started a serious crackdown on drug
users in June this year and so far over 7,800 drug users
have been arrested.
